Revisions of diskimage-builder
Tomáš Chvátal (scarabeus_iv)
accepted
request 693769
from
Markos Chandras (markoschandras)
(revision 48)
- Version bump to 2.21.0 * Minor clarifications in centos7 element docs * Unmount internal mounts on finalise errors * Add DIB_APT_MINIMAL_CREATE_INTERFACES toggle * [lvm] Add Ubuntu bionic as supported distro
buildservice-autocommit
accepted
request 686317
from
Tomáš Chvátal (scarabeus_iv)
(revision 47)
baserev update by copy to link target
Tomáš Chvátal (scarabeus_iv)
accepted
request 686257
from
John Vandenberg (jayvdb)
(revision 46)
- Relax egg-info requirement flake8 >=2.5.4,<2.6.0 which is incompatible with available flake8 3.x
buildservice-autocommit
accepted
request 682594
from
Tomáš Chvátal (scarabeus_iv)
(revision 45)
baserev update by copy to link target
Tomáš Chvátal (scarabeus_iv)
accepted
request 682520
from
Markos Chandras (markoschandras)
(revision 44)
- Version bump to 2.20.3 * Update gentoo-releng gpg key * Fix opensuse 42.3 pip-and-virtualenv * Keep git after ironic-agent post * set rhel minor release * update spelling errors
buildservice-autocommit
accepted
request 676958
from
Tomáš Chvátal (scarabeus_iv)
(revision 43)
baserev update by copy to link target
Tomáš Chvátal (scarabeus_iv)
accepted
request 676537
from
Markos Chandras (markoschandras)
(revision 42)
- Version bump to 2.20.1 * pip-and-virtualenv: handle centos image-based builds * pip-and-virtualenv : only remove system files on centos * Enable dbus-broker for Fedora 29 * fix systemd import-tar for gentoo * Add python3-setuptools to bindep.txt for Fedora * support cracklib in pam for Gentoo's musl profile * Make sure $TMP_BUILD_DIR/mnt is owned by root * change to python36 for gentoo * source-repositories: Replace documentation http with https links * Delete the duplicate words in 50-zipl * Change phase to check for dracut-regenerate in iscsi-boot * Add policycoreutils-python-utils to bindep * Use template for lower-constraints * simple-init: allow for NetworkManager support * package-installs: provide for skip from env var * Add an element to configure iBFT network interfaces * move selinux-permissive configure to pre-install phase * Update to Fedora 29 * Increase size of EFI system partition
buildservice-autocommit
accepted
request 646589
from
Dirk Mueller (dirkmueller)
(revision 41)
baserev update by copy to link target
Dirk Mueller (dirkmueller)
accepted
request 646577
from
Markos Chandras (markoschandras)
(revision 40)
- Version bump to 2.18.0 * Add ubuntu-systemd-container operating-system element * Turn on quiet mode when logfile specified * Fix epel repo rewrite, add to testing * Add a post-root.d phase * Fix DIB_DISTRIBUTION_MIRROR_UBUNTU_IGNORE regex typo * Add support for Fedora 28, remove EOL Fedora 26 * ubuntu: Add options to ignore mirror components and use insecure repos * simplify overlay logic for Gentoo * simplify python3.6 selection on gentoo * Turn down pkg-map and hook copy tracing output * enable caching for gentoo builds * Add a pre-finalise.d phase * Minor documentation updates * Allow debootstrap to cleanup without a kernel * Fail build due to missing kauditd only when SELinux is enabled * Fix DIB ubuntu-minimal running on bionic (18.04) * ubuntu-common: Update default DIB_RELEASE to bionic * Move common ubuntu environment setting to ubuntu-common element * allow building non-gentoo images on gentoo hosts
buildservice-autocommit
accepted
request 635709
from
Dirk Mueller (dirkmueller)
(revision 39)
baserev update by copy to link target
Dirk Mueller (dirkmueller)
accepted
request 635708
from
Markos Chandras (markoschandras)
(revision 38)
- Version bump to 2.17.0 * Only append DIB_BOOTLOADER_DEFAULT_CMDLINE to default grub entry * Fix CentOS image build failure when dib runs on system where audit disabled * Fix bootloader packages for aarch64 * Install ca-certificate with redhat-common * Add netcat to redhat-common map-packages * Only detach device if all partitions have been cleaned * Move LVM cleanup phase into cleanup * Add DIB element to blacklist nouveau * modprobe DIB_MODPROBE_BLACKLIST should be optional * cache-url requires curl * Fix for proper LVM support * Call kpartx remove in umount, not cleanup * block-device lvm: fix umount phase * Don't quote names with sgdisk * better handle existing keywords files/directories * IPA requires iptables * Install sudo on Gentoo images by deault
buildservice-autocommit
accepted
request 624031
from
Ondřej Súkup (mimi_vx)
(revision 37)
baserev update by copy to link target
Ondřej Súkup (mimi_vx)
accepted
request 623931
from
Markos Chandras (markoschandras)
(revision 36)
- Version bump to 2.16.0 * Update pylint to 1.7.6, uncap networkx * Add expected semicolons for dhclient.conf * Add keyring if supplied * Add new modprobe element * Add iscsi-boot element for CentOS images * Fix /etc/network/interfaces file contents * Convert labels to upper case * Fix bootloader for efi on rhel systems * Don't run setfiles on /boot/efi * Add iscsi-boot element * Fix bootloader packages for rhel * Don't install zypper on bionic * Rename output log files * Save and close stdout on exit * Reduce path length in PS4 for debug * Use surrogateescape with outfilter.py * Fix encoding issue during processing output - Package improvements * convert to python3 * Improve description * spec-cleaner fixes
buildservice-autocommit
accepted
request 616235
from
Markos Chandras (markoschandras)
(revision 35)
baserev update by copy to link target
Markos Chandras (markoschandras)
committed
(revision 34)
- Version bump to 2.15.1 (bsc#1097115)
Ondřej Súkup (mimi_vx)
accepted
request 614938
from
Markos Chandras (markoschandras)
(revision 33)
- Version bump to 2.15.1 * elements: pip-and-virtualenv: Handle openSUSE Leap 15 * Allow to rebuild arbitrary images * Replace the ubuntu-minimal trusty test with a bionic one * Remove non-maintained ubuntu-core element * elements: zypper-minimal: Add support for openSUSE Leap 15.X * Add Ubuntu 18.04 support * Remove duplicate GRUB command line entry * rpm-distro: set the contentdir yum var * Trivial: update url to new url * Fixes add-apt-keys in dpkg element * Add pip cache cleanup to pip-and-virtualenv * pip-and-virtualenv: fix install-pip when centos-release-openstack is enabled * Stop using slave_scripts/install-distro-packages.sh
buildservice-autocommit
accepted
request 602548
from
Tomáš Chvátal (scarabeus_iv)
(revision 32)
baserev update by copy to link target
Tomáš Chvátal (scarabeus_iv)
accepted
request 602517
from
Markos Chandras (markoschandras)
(revision 31)
- Version bump to 2.14.1 * Fix epel element for centos-minimal * Revert "debootstrap: Call update-initramfs explicitly" * Remove installed packages before pip install * Don't only install python3-virtualenv * Don't use -e to test for what might be broken symlink * add lower-constraints job * Set the dhclient timeout to match DIB_DHCP_TIMEOUT * Formalise saving of /etc/resolv.conf * Restore tracing on exit points of block_device_create_config_file * delete unused module * debootstrap: Call update-initramfs explicitly * Change the GENTOO_PORTAGE_CLEANUP variable default * Fix element-provides in debian element * Revert "Remove tripleo jobs" * enable systemd profile for Gentoo * install sudo in the devuser element * Fix default partition type * Remove tripleo jobs * remove portage git directory * Updated from global requirements * Updated from global requirements * proliant-tools: add net-tools package to support hpsum utility * Make the build reproducible * Updated from global requirements * secondary architectures use different url * Fix for rhel7 iso image creation. * Fix for passing user defined value for satellite cert for rhel-common. * arm64: use HWE kernel and fix console * Choose appropriate bootloader for block-device
buildservice-autocommit
accepted
request 584983
from
Tomáš Chvátal (scarabeus_iv)
(revision 30)
baserev update by copy to link target
Tomáš Chvátal (scarabeus_iv)
accepted
request 584825
from
Markos Chandras (markoschandras)
(revision 29)
- Version bump to 2.11.0 * Install systemd earlier for Ubuntu Bionic * update gentoo vars for new profile and python * Set default label for XFS disks * Don't install dmidecode on Fedora ppc64le * Updated from global requirements * Add support for Fedora 27, remove EOL Fedora 25 * Don't fstrim vfat partitions * Remove RH1 check OVB jobs from configuration * upgrade pip before using -c option * Correct link address * Updated from global requirements * Add SUSE Mapping * Revert "Dont install python-pip for py3k" * Adding mapping for SUSE package * Check source-repository-* files for trailing newline * ironic-agent: don't remove make * Remove architecture rules on lshw dependency in ironic-agent * zypper: fix package removal * Avoid tox_install.sh for constraints support * Fix wrong epel-release-7* package URL * Add the groundwork for musl profile support * Enable support for Gentoo overlays * Pre-install curl * Install fedora-gpg-keys for F27 * Make preinstall.d more deterministic * Use EPEL for debootstrap on centos * Fix /dev/pts mount options handling * Make python changes more reliable * Remove setting of version/release from releasenotes
Displaying revisions 21 - 40 of 68